logo

百度图像识别API:解锁AI视觉的无限可能

作者:很酷cat2025.09.18 17:44浏览量:0

简介:本文深度解析百度图像识别API的核心功能、技术架构、应用场景及开发实践,助力开发者快速集成AI视觉能力,实现图像分类、物体检测、场景识别等智能化需求。

百度图像识别API:解锁AI视觉的无限可能

一、技术背景与核心优势

百度图像识别API是基于深度学习框架构建的云端视觉服务,依托百度多年在计算机视觉领域的技术积累,提供高精度、低延迟的图像分析能力。其核心优势体现在三个方面:

1. 算法先进性

采用自研的PaddlePaddle深度学习框架,支持ResNet、YOLO等主流模型架构,并通过持续迭代优化模型结构。例如,在ImageNet图像分类任务中,其Top-1准确率达92.3%,超越人类平均水平(91.2%)。针对特定场景,百度还开发了轻量化模型,如MobileNetV3变体,可在移动端实现实时推理。

2. 多模态融合能力

除传统RGB图像外,API支持红外、深度图等多模态输入,结合时空特征提取技术,可实现复杂场景下的精准识别。例如,在自动驾驶场景中,通过融合激光雷达点云与摄像头图像,提升障碍物检测的鲁棒性。

3. 弹性扩展架构

基于百度智能云的分布式计算平台,API支持从单张图片到百万级图像的弹性处理。通过动态资源调度,开发者可根据业务峰值自动扩容,避免因流量突增导致的服务中断。实测数据显示,在10万QPS(每秒查询数)压力下,平均响应时间仍控制在200ms以内。

二、核心功能模块详解

百度图像识别API提供五大类共20+细分功能,覆盖从基础图像处理到高级语义理解的完整链条:

1. 图像分类与标注

  • 功能:识别图像中的主体类别,返回标签及置信度分数
  • 技术实现:采用多尺度特征融合网络,支持10,000+细粒度类别
  • 应用场景:电商商品分类、社交媒体内容审核
  • 代码示例
    ```python
    import requests

url = “https://aip.baidubce.com/rest/2.0/image-classify/v2/advanced_general
params = {“access_token”: “YOUR_ACCESS_TOKEN”}
headers = {“content-type”: “application/x-www-form-urlencoded”}
data = {“image”: “base64_encoded_image”}

response = requests.post(url, params=params, headers=headers, data=data)
print(response.json())
```

2. 物体检测与定位

  • 功能:检测图像中多个物体的位置及类别
  • 技术亮点:支持旋转框检测,解决倾斜物体识别难题
  • 性能指标:在COCO数据集上,mAP(平均精度)达54.2%
  • 典型应用:工业质检、安防监控

3. 场景识别与OCR

  • 场景识别:可识别海滩、城市等30+常见场景
  • OCR识别:支持中英文混合、手写体识别,准确率超99%
  • 创新功能:表格识别、公式识别等垂直场景优化

4. 图像质量评估

  • 评估维度:清晰度、噪声、曝光等12项指标
  • 算法原理:基于无参考图像质量评价(NR-IQA)技术
  • 行业应用:摄影设备测试、医疗影像质控

5. 自定义模型训练

提供可视化训练平台,支持:

  • 数据标注:半自动标注工具提升效率
  • 模型微调:基于预训练模型的迁移学习
  • 增量学习:持续优化模型性能

三、开发实践指南

1. 快速入门流程

  1. 获取访问权限

    • 注册百度智能云账号
    • 创建图像识别应用,获取API Key和Secret Key
    • 调用get_access_token接口获取认证令牌
  2. API调用方式

    • RESTful API:适合跨语言调用
    • SDK集成:提供Python、Java等多语言SDK
    • 命令行工具:支持批量图片处理
  3. 错误处理机制

    • 定义明确的错误码体系(如110表示参数错误)
    • 提供重试机制和熔断策略

2. 性能优化技巧

  • 批量处理:单次请求最多支持50张图片
  • 区域部署:选择就近接入点(华北、华东、华南)
  • 模型选择:根据精度/速度需求选择通用模型或轻量模型
  • 缓存策略:对重复图片建立本地缓存

3. 安全合规建议

  • 数据传输:强制使用HTTPS协议
  • 隐私保护:支持图像本地化处理选项
  • 审计日志:记录所有API调用详情
  • 合规认证:通过ISO 27001、GDPR等国际认证

四、行业应用案例解析

1. 零售行业解决方案

某连锁超市通过部署图像识别API实现:

  • 货架商品识别准确率98.7%
  • 库存盘点效率提升300%
  • 动态定价系统响应时间<1秒

2. 医疗影像分析

与三甲医院合作开发:

  • CT影像肺结节检测灵敏度96.2%
  • 糖尿病视网膜病变分级准确率94.5%
  • 单张影像分析时间从15分钟缩短至2秒

3. 智慧城市应用

在某国家级新区部署:

  • 交通违法识别准确率99.1%
  • 占道经营检测覆盖率100%
  • 事件响应时间从30分钟降至5分钟

五、未来发展趋势

  1. 3D视觉扩展:支持点云数据解析,推动自动驾驶、机器人导航发展
  2. 视频流分析:实现实时视频中的目标跟踪与行为识别
  3. 小样本学习:降低模型训练所需数据量,加速垂直领域落地
  4. 边缘计算集成:与百度EdgeBoard等硬件深度结合

六、开发者支持体系

  1. 文档中心:提供完整的API参考手册、示例代码和FAQ
  2. 技术社区:活跃的开发者论坛,每周举办线上技术沙龙
  3. 企业服务:为大型客户提供专属技术架构师支持
  4. 培训体系:开设从入门到进阶的系列课程,颁发认证证书

百度图像识别API正以每年30%的性能提升速度持续进化,其开放生态已吸引超过50万开发者入驻。对于希望快速实现AI视觉能力的团队,建议从通用图像分类API入手,逐步探索物体检测、场景识别等高级功能,最终通过自定义模型训练打造差异化竞争力。在数字化转型浪潮中,掌握这一工具将为企业创造显著的技术壁垒和商业价值。

相关文章推荐

发表评论